Erik Sabrowski, David Bednar, Lucas Erceg, JoJo Romero each had three SV+HLD’s over the first week of the season, with Sabrowski picking up FOUR so far. I was excited for Sabrowski this year, but I did not expect this start to the season. He has an elite pitch mix with a high iVB four-seamer and a pair of whipeout breakers, it’s just always been about the command (and health) with him. He’s healthy now and commanding his stuff well enough that he should be rostered in all holds formats. He’s in such a good spot in that Guardians bullpen as the top lefty and has more swing and miss upside than almost any non-closer reliever out there.
Also, let’s remember that we are just 1 week into the 26-week season, so let’s not panic too much with those who have not had success so far.

- Not a great start to the season for Emilio Pagán, and I think it’s more related to location than his velocity being down. He was also due for some regression, I just don’t think we thought it’d hit so early.
- Tony Santillan’s four-seamer averaged 97.2 MPH in 2024, 96.3 MPH in 2025, and this year currently sits at…93.9 MPH. Something to monitor there.
- Graham Ashcraft, on the other hand, is throwing his cutter harder than he ever has (99 MPH), and his slider is sitting at a ridiculous 93 MPH. That’s peak Emmanuel Clase velo numbers, but just to be clear, Ashcraft’s arsenal doesn’t have quite the same movement profile as Clase had. Francona loved to lean on Clase in Cleveland, though, so perhaps we could see Ashcraft work his way into the closer role eventually.
- If Connor Phillips could just have some consistent fastball command, he’d also be in the mix to be the next closer in Cincinnati. The sweeper is a legit weapon, and the four-seamer sits at 98+ MPH, he just can’t locate it…yet. Still a very fun arm to chase.

- Bryan Abreu’s velo has been down about 3 MPH, and he’s had no command, so heading into yesterday’s outing, I was very concerned. He started Roman Anthony off with a 94.6 MPH fastball, then threw two sliders, the second of which resulted in a HR. BUT THEN, he bounced back with three straight strikeouts, throwing a 95.5 MPH fastball to the next batter, and with his last four fastballs, he was 97.4 MPH, 96 MPH, 96 MPH, and 97.3 MPH. That should give us something to be optimistic about, at least (but also, why are the velocities all over the place?).
- AJ Blubaugh should probably be starting, but if the Astros want to use him as a one-inning reliever, I am very intrigued. As a reliever, he has closer stuff with three plus pitches in his fastball, sweeper, and changeup, and the Astros desperately need right-handed bullpen help. Ryan Weiss is kind of in the same boat, but not quite as dominant.

- Camilo Doval was sitting 97 MPH in his second game, where he was throwing whiffle balls to Giants hitters, but since then, the velocity has dropped off, down to 94 MPH with his sinker and 95 MPH with his cutter. Those pitches are usually in the 97-98 MPH range, so something to keep an eye on.
- I still have Brent Headrick over Tim Hill, mostly due to upside, but also the thought that eventually Tim Hill won’t have this crazy good command, right? Headrick can miss bats regularly, while Hill is just smoke and mirrors. Maybe he is the left-handed Tyler Rogers, but I can’t endorse that quite yet.
